Как импортировать и экспортировать данные в Microsoft Excel

Зачем это нужно
Импорт и экспорт данных позволяют объединять информацию из разных источников, автоматизировать обновления и делиться результатами с людьми, у которых нет Excel. Импорт — загрузка внешних данных в книгу Excel. Экспорт — сохранение книги в другом формате для использования в другом ПО или для публикации.
Важно: определите цель до начала — интеграция, отчёт, обмен или архивирование — это влияет на выбор формата и рабочего процесса.
Как импортировать данные в Excel
Определение: импорт — это процесс загрузки данных из внешнего источника (файл, база, веб) в лист Excel.
Совет: всегда работайте с копией файла и делайте резервную копию книги перед массовым импортом.
- Откройте книгу Excel, в которую будете импортировать данные.
- На ленте откройте вкладку “Данные”.

- Нажмите “Получить данные” (Get Data) и выберите источник: файл, база данных, веб и т. д.

- Чтобы импортировать текстовый файл или CSV: выберите Получить данные > Из файла > Из текста/CSV.
- В проводнике укажите CSV и предварительно просмотрите содержимое.

- При необходимости примените преобразования (“Преобразовать данные” — откроется Power Query). Если изменений не нужно — нажмите “Загрузить”.

Пояснение: Power Query — встроенный инструмент для чистки и преобразования данных перед загрузкой.
Краткая последовательность для импортов: Выбрать источник → Просмотр → Преобразовать (опционально) → Загрузить.
Импорт данных из веба
Импорт с веб‑страницы полезен, когда на сайте есть таблицы с официальной статистикой, котировки или списки. Excel скачивает таблицы и удерживает связь с источником.
- Откройте книгу и вкладку “Данные”.
- Нажмите “Из интернета” (From Web).
- Вставьте URL в поле и подтвердите.

- Выберите таблицу в панели Навигатор и нажмите “Загрузить”. Можно выбрать “Выбрать несколько элементов”.

Преимущества:
- Автоматическое обновление: при обновлении страницы можно нажать “Обновить” в Excel.
- Нет ручного копирования/вставки.
Ограничения:
- Динамический контент (JavaScript) может не отображаться корректно.
- Структура страницы может измениться — запрос придётся править.
Пример: импорт таблицы результатов турнира с Википедии. Вы выбираете таблицу “Results” в Навигаторе и загружаете её в лист. При изменении таблицы на сайте можно обновить данные одним кликом.
Важно: импорт с веба работает корректно в Microsoft 365/Office 2016 и новее. Для старых версий функционал может отсутствовать.
Импорт из Microsoft Access
Microsoft Access — реляционная СУБД для небольших приложений. Экспорт из Access в Excel удобен для аналитики и построения графиков.
Шаги:
- Создайте пустую книгу в Excel.
- На вкладке “Данные” выберите Получить данные > Из базы данных > Из базы данных Microsoft Access.
- Укажите файл .accdb/.mdb.
- В Навигаторе выберите таблицы или запросы и загрузите их.
Совет: если требуется изменить данные при импортe, выберите “Преобразовать данные” (Power Query).
Когда использовать Access: у вас есть готовая структура с отношениями и запросами, и вы хотите подтянуть только результаты запросов в Excel.
Экспорт данных из Excel
Экспорт — создание файла в формате, отличном от .xlsx, для передачи, публикации или загрузки в другое ПО.
- Файл > Экспорт.

- Нажмите “Сменить тип файла”.

- Выберите формат и нажмите “Сохранить как”. Укажите папку и имя файла.

Частые форматы:
- xlsx/xls — стандарт Excel.
- xlt/xltx — шаблон Excel.
- xlsb — бинарный формат, быстрее сохраняется при больших объёмах.
- CSV — текст с разделителями, читается любым табличным редактором.
- TXT — варианты с табом в качестве разделителя.
Примечание: при выборе формата, отличного от xlsx, Excel предупредит о возможной потере функционала (макросы, формулы, форматы). Это нормальная часть работы — подтвердите сохранение, если потеря функции допустима.
Частые сценарии и рекомендации
- Нужен обмен с другими системами (BI, СУБД): экспортируйте в CSV или используйте ODBC/ODBC‑подключения.
- Нужна автоматизация отчётов: связывайте данные через Power Query и используйте планировщик (или макросы) для обновлений.
- Большие объёмы данных: сохраняйте в xlsb для скорости и уменьшенного размера.
- Совместная работа с пользователями без Excel: экспортируйте в CSV или PDF в зависимости от задачи (данные vs презентация).
Когда импорт или экспорт не сработает — типичные ошибки
- Неправильная кодировка CSV (например, UTF‑8 vs Windows‑1251) — результат: кракозябры. Решение: открыть в Power Query и указать кодировку при импорте.
- Динамический или защищённый веб‑контент — Excel не увидит таблицу. Решение: использовать API сайта или парсер, а затем импортировать полученные файлы.
- Несовпадающие разделители в CSV (запятая/точка с запятой) — Excel неверно разбивает столбцы. Решение: укажите разделитель при импорте.
- Формулы и макросы теряются при сохранении в CSV/TXT — экспортируйте копию в xlsx/xlsb и затем — CSV для данных.
- Большие таблицы требуют много памяти — используйте Power Pivot или загрузку частями.
Альтернативные подходы
- Использовать Google Sheets для быстрого совместного редактирования и затем экспорт в XLSX/CSV.
- Прямое подключение к источникам через ODBC/ODBC‑коннекторы вместо экспорта файлов.
- Экспорт JSON/XML для интеграции с веб‑сервисами.
- Скрипты на Python (pandas) для сложных трансформаций и пакетной обработки файлов.
Когда выбирать альтернативу: если источник обеспечивает API, это надежнее и безопаснее, чем парсинг HTML.
Ментальные модели и эвристики
- Источник → Транспорт → Преобразование → Погружение (STTP: Source, Transport, Transform, Persist). Простой чек: где хранятся «сырые» данные, кто их обновляет и кто их потребляет.
- Минимизация изменений: импортируйте данные в неизменном виде, трансформируйте в Power Query, а оригиналы сохраняйте в отдельной папке.
- Правило 3‑2‑1 для резервных копий: 3 копии, 2 разных носителя, 1 вне площадки (подходит для критичных рабочих книг).
Мини‑методология: PLAN → BACKUP → IMPORT → VALIDATE → SAVE
- PLAN: определить цель импорта/экспорта, формат, частоту обновлений.
- BACKUP: сделать резервную копию книги и исходных файлов.
- IMPORT: выбрать метод (Файл/Веб/БД), выполнить предварительный просмотр.
- VALIDATE: проверить типы данных, количество строк, ключевые значения (нет дубликатов, даты читаются верно).
- SAVE: сохранить копию итоговой книги и документировать источник и параметры импорта.
Чеклисты по ролям
Аналитик:
- Проверил структуру и семантику столбцов.
- Применил фильтры и проверки качества (NULL, дубликаты).
- Задокументировал источник и расписание обновлений.
Обычный пользователь:
- Создал копию файла перед импортом.
- Использовал “Загрузить” для быстрого импорта или “Преобразовать данные” при необходимости чистки.
- Сохранил итог в нужном формате для передачи.
Системный администратор:
- Настроил права доступа к папке с исходными файлами.
- При необходимости организовал ODBC/ODBC‑подключение к СУБД.
- Обеспечил соответствие кодировок и сетевой безопасности.
Критерии приёмки
Импорт считается успешным, если выполнены все пункты:
- Количество строк совпадает с ожидаемым или в допустимой погрешности.
- Ключевые столбцы заполнены корректно (идентификаторы, даты, суммы).
- Формат данных соответствует требованиям (числа, даты, тексты).
- Автоматическое обновление не ломается при повторной загрузке.
- Документация импорта обновлена (источник, дата, шаги трансформации).
Контроль качества и тесты приёма
Тестовые сценарии:
- Загрузить тестовый CSV с известными проблемами (отсутствующие значения, лишние разделители) и подтвердить, что Power Query исправляет их.
- Обновить данные на сайте и проверить, обновятся ли таблицы в Excel.
- Экспортировать книгу в CSV и открыть в другом редакторе, убедиться, что столбцы совпадают.
Пошаговый шаблон SOP для типового импорта
- Подготовка: сохранить копию целевой книги в папку \Backup\YYYYMMDD.
- Получение файла: скачать исходный файл в папку \Import\YYYYMMDD.
- Импорт: Данные → Получить данные → выбрать источник → Предварительный просмотр.
- Преобразование: в Power Query выполнить очистку (удалить лишние столбцы, переименовать, изменить типы).
- Загрузка: Загрузить в таблицу или модель данных.
- Проверка: сверить контрольные суммы/количества строк.
- Документирование: обновить журнал импорта с датой, источником, описанием шагов.
- Очистка: удалить временные файлы.
Галерея исключительных случаев
- Импорт финансовых отчётов с валютами: следите за разделителем десятичных и тысячных разрядов.
- Даты в разных форматах: dd.MM.yyyy vs MM/dd/yyyy — явно указывайте формат при преобразовании.
- Большие вложенные таблицы в HTML: иногда удобнее выгрузить CSV с сайта, если доступно.
Пример принятия решения (дерево)
flowchart TD
A[Нужно импортировать данные?] --> B{Источник данных}
B -->|Файл| C[CSV/TXT/XLSX]
B -->|Веб| D[Попробовать From Web]
B -->|БД| E[ODBC/From Database]
C --> F{Требуется очистка}
F -->|Да| G[Power Query → Преобразовать → Загрузить]
F -->|Нет| H[Загрузить]
D --> I{Таблица доступна}
I -->|Да| H
I -->|Нет| J[Использовать API/скрипт]
E --> K[Выбрать таблицу/запрос → Загрузить]Часто задаваемые вопросы
Q: Что делать, если при импорте CSV неправильно отображаются русские символы? A: Выберите правильную кодировку (обычно UTF‑8 или Windows‑1251) в диалоге импорта или откройте файл в Power Query и укажите кодировку.
Q: Как автоматизировать обновление импортированных данных? A: В Power Query используйте кнопку “Обновить” вручную, а для автоматизации — макросы, планировщик задач или Power Automate (в Microsoft 365).
Q: Можно ли импортировать защищённые веб‑страницы? A: Если контент доступен через API — используйте API. Если доступ защищён авторизацией, потребуется настроить аутентификацию (в некоторых случаях Excel поддерживает базовую аутентификацию в запросах).
Итоговая сводка
- Импорт и экспорт в Excel — стандартные операции: Файл, Веб, База данных.
- Power Query — основной инструмент для предварительной обработки данных.
- Планируйте, делайте резервные копии и документируйте процесс.
- Используйте подходящий формат при экспорте: CSV для данных, PDF для презентации, xlsb для больших объёмов.
Важно: работайте с копиями, подтверждайте кодировку и проверяйте типы данных после импорта.
Сводка в одном абзаце: если вам нужно собрать данные из разных мест, начните с простого импорта через вкладку “Данные”, воспользуйтесь Power Query для очистки, а затем сохраните результат в формате, подходящем для потребителя данных. Документируйте источник и проверяйте корректность автоматически.
Похожие материалы
Cheogram + JMP: как отказаться от оператора
Оптимизация роутера: настройка, безопасность, покрытие
Как набрать логотип Apple на iPhone, iPad и Mac
Переместить панель задач в Windows 11
Файл .htaccess: назначение и примеры